介绍

关系图谱采用 vue2 + AntV G6open in new windowv4.8.21 开发

术语说明

基础术语

图表载体 Graphopen in new window

Graph 是 G6 图表的载体,所有的 G6 节点实例操作以及事件,行为监听都在 Graph 实例上进行。Graph 的初始化通过 new 进行实例化,实例化时需要传入需要的参数。

实体 Nodeopen in new window

实体为每一个可连接的对象

关系 Edgeopen in new window

关系为 实体实体 之间的连线

布局 Layoutopen in new window

指各种算法实现的关系图谱布局

交互 Behavioropen in new window

指图上交互事件的机制

业务中的内容

N 度关系

指实体和实体之间的关系连接层级

普通视图数据 context

业务数据中保存的普通视图数据

关系视图数据 relationViewContent

业务数据中保存的关系视图数据

锁定

锁定后的实体 不可移动

路径推演

选择 2个 实体后,调用 后端 接口,返回两个实体之间的连接线路,且高亮这两个实体以及关系,其他实体和关系透明显示

连接分析

选择 1个 实体后,调用 后端 接口,分析此实体和其他实体之间的关系连接,且高亮这个实体以及有关系连接的实体,其他实体和关系透明显示

社群分析

分析 所有 实体的 1度 关系的节点数量,前端 过滤所有实体,符合条件的高亮节点,其他节点透明显示

关系视图

右击 实体 点击关系视图,调用 后端 接口,重新渲染画布展示此 实体 的关系视图与正常视图有差异

上次更新:
贡献者: zml